One of the first steps that most event planners take is gaining a relevant bachelor’s degree for the role. Degrees in hospitality or public relations are often aspiring event planners’ top choices, as these programs offer courses specifically to help you plan events.1. Choose Your Niche. The first step is to decide what kind of parties you want to specialize in. This is also called finding your niche. Think about the types of events that interest you and the ones you have experience with – this will help narrow your focus so that you can build a successful business.

A good way to break in, would be an admin asst at a hotel in their sales/catering department. Then you would go into the banquet side and then convention service manager and then from there. Of course there are a lot of other ways. The above way will take about a year in each position. Event planner seems like a "fun" job but you have to have a ...

Other duties that an event planner performs include: Meeting with clients to understand the purpose of the event. Planning the scope of the event, including cost, time, location and program. Inspecting places to make sure they meet the client's requirements. Step 1: Earn a Bachelor’s Degree. Most event planners only earn a bachelor’s degree. There are a few different degrees you can pursue, the most common being in meeting and event management, business administration or management, or hospitality management and marketing. Any one of these degrees will get you a job as an event planner, so ...

Then, get an education from a college or university.Some programs accept students as young as 16, as long as a parent or legal guardian is willing to sign a consent form giving them permission to enroll. In most places, event planning is an unregulated industry. States and provinces that do require licensing, however, also require you to be at least 18 years old to take the test.Everyone loves a good party, whether it's holiday parties, birthday parties, engagement parties, children's parties, or any other type of party.
